Output ecd2af30822277450b3bf669565a6f26dba5e97f09f7f16849778d79a11541a7:62

value
21336
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8c15c644bfb0dfef22e819b651633cec2b77ffbcc62c386c67a473f54de36aa6
address
bc1p3s2uv39lkr077ghgrxm9zceuas4h0laucckrsmr853el2n0rd2nqw0w9mt
transaction
ecd2af30822277450b3bf669565a6f26dba5e97f09f7f16849778d79a11541a7
spent
true